Suspect in Charlie Kirk Murder Case Taken into Custody: Details Emerge Following Arrest
In a shocking turn of events, authorities have arrested the suspect linked to the murder of Charlie Kirk, a prominent right-wing activist. The suspect, identified as Tyler Robinson, a man in his 20s, was apprehended late last night in St. George, Utah, near the scenic Zion National Park.
The announcement came from President Trump during an interview with Fox & Friends, where he confirmed that Robinson was taken into custody after being turned in by someone “close to him.” Trump emphasized the collaborative effort between local and federal law enforcement in capturing the suspect, noting the significant role played by community members in the process.
“I think that with a high degree of certainty we have him in custody,” Trump stated, reflecting the confidence expressed by law enforcement officials in their pursuit of leads related to the case. The president provided additional context on how the arrest unfolded, revealing the involvement of a minister associated with law enforcement, whose friend, a top marshal, helped facilitate the process. “They drove him to the police headquarters,” Trump explained, highlighting the critical role of community engagement in solving the case.
The tragic incident occurred Wednesday during an event at Utah Valley University, leading to a wave of shock and mourning throughout the community and beyond. Trump did not shy away from expressing his views on justice, stating, “I hope he gets the death penalty,” a sentiment that underscores the emotional intensity surrounding this case.
As investigations continue, a press conference is scheduled for 2:30 PM UK time, where further updates from the FBI are expected. Authorities remain committed to ensuring that justice is served, as they delve deeper into the circumstances leading to Kirk’s untimely death.
